Summoners Summoning Summons by oxrock
Defend your honor as a summoner!
Gameplay is simple. Use mana to queue up summons to perform. With summons queued, send them forth with the "Send Wave" button. Choose wisely to counter the enemy's summons and prove once and for all that nobody does summoning quite like you do.

Extra Information
Earth Elemental
* attack type: single target
* attack speed: 0.333 attacks per second
* movement speed: 1
* attack range: 50
* health: 100
* attack damage: 8
Fire Elemental
* attack type: AOE frontal cone
* attack speed: 0.5 attacks per second
* movement speed: 2
* attack range: 200
* health: 65
* attack damage: 6
Wind Elemental
* attack type: AOE radius around elemental
* attack speed: 0.333 attacks per second
* movement speed: 3
* attack range: 100
* health: 80
* attack damage: 10
